“Open” means anyone may attend — including family, friends, and anyone curious about the program.
“Closed” means the meeting is for people who have — or think they may have — a drinking problem. Newcomers are welcome.

About Alcoholics Anonymous
Alcoholics Anonymous is a fellowship of people who help each other recover from alcoholism. There are no dues or fees, and the only requirement for membership is a desire to stop drinking.
